What Are Mortgage Loan Pre-Approvals?
A home loan pre-approval serves as a stamp of approval from lenders confirming your financial readiness to buy a home. Before you get pre-approved, the lender will evaluate your debt-to-income ratio and creditworthiness. Upon approval, you will receive a statement that serves as their conditional commitment to lending you money to buy your home while also showing how much they are willing to give you.
Pre-approval Vs Prequalification - What's The Difference?
A prequalification gives you a rough idea of how much you can borrow based on what you tell the lender about your finances. Pre-approval, on the other hand, means the lender has checked and confirmed your financial information, giving you a conditional thumbs-up for a specific loan amount.

Do Pre-approvals Affect Your Credit Score?
Before you get preapproved for a mortgage, lenders carry out a hard pull of your credit to check your score, temporarily lowering it by a few points. However, you will have a 45-day window in which multiple credit score inquiries will be considered on your credit report. Are you worried about denial? Texas mortgage guidelines emphasize a strong financial profile. Minimum credit score thresholds typically start at 620 for conventional loans, though higher scores (around 740+) unlock better rates. Income verification involves reviewing stable earnings, and debt-to-income (DTI) ratios should ideally stay below 43% for front-end and 50% for back-end calculations. - Minimum Credit Score Guidelines: Lenders in Texas, including for Comal County applicants, generally require a FICO score of at least 620 for most mortgage programs. FHA loans may accept scores as low as 580 with a larger down payment, while VA and USDA options can be more flexible for eligible borrowers. - Required Documentation like Pay Stubs and Tax Returns: To verify income, you'll need to provide recent pay stubs (typically the last 30 days), W-2 forms for the past two years, and federal tax returns (also two years). Self-employed applicants in Comal County should submit profit and loss statements. Bank statements for two to three months help confirm reserves. - Employment History and Stability Factors: Lenders prefer at least two years of steady employment in the same field, with no gaps longer than six months. For Comal County residents in growing sectors like construction or healthcare, this stability is crucial. If you've changed jobs recently, a letter explaining the transition can help. - Impact of Comal County's Property Tax Rates: Comal County has relatively high property tax rates compared to the national average, primarily funding excellent local schools and infrastructure. These taxes, which can range from 2.0% to 2.5% of assessed value, directly affect your monthly housing costs and debt-to-income ratio during pre-approval.
